What is E-A-T?

Introduced by Google as part of their Search Quality Evaluator Guidelines, E-A-T serves as a framework for evaluating the quality of web content. It helps ensure that users receive information from reliable sources, which is especially important in critical fields such as health, finance, and news.

Expertise: Relates to the creator of the content. It requires demonstrating a high level of skill or knowledge in a particular area. For instance, an article on medical advice should ideally be authored by a health professional or someone with relevant qualifications.

Authoritativeness: This aspect evaluates the creator’s recognized influence in their field. Authoritative content typically comes from individuals who are widely acknowledged in their industry or niche.

Trustworthiness: This is about the reliability and accuracy of the content, as well as the site’s overall reputation. Trustworthiness can be fostered by presenting factual information and maintaining transparency in sources and affiliations.

Why is E-A-T Important for SEO?

Google’s prioritization of E-A-T reflects their commitment to fighting misinformation and promoting credible content. By integrating E-A-T principles, websites can enhance their chances of ranking high in search engine results pages (SERPs). Key reasons for prioritizing E-A-T include:

  • Improving User Confidence: Providing high-quality, expert-backed content increases user trust, leading to better engagement, longer site visits, and potentially higher conversion rates.
  • Aligning with Google’s Focus: As Google refines its algorithm, aligning content with E-A-T can secure better rankings and shield your site from potential algorithmic penalties.
  • Boosting Reputation: High E-A-T content fosters a strong brand presence, as users and other industry players are more likely to reference and share reputable content.

How to Enhance E-A-T on Your Website

Here are practical ways to ensure your content aligns with E-A-T guidelines:

  1. Showcase Credentials: Highlight author biographies, professional qualifications, and affiliations on your site to demonstrate expertise.
  2. Gain Authoritative Backlinks: Foster relationships with reputable sites and aim for high-authority backlinks to boost perceived authority.
  3. Maintain Transparency and Honesty: Clearly cite sources, present balanced views, and make corrections visible to build trust.
  4. Encourage Customer Reviews: Positive reviews and testimonials can enhance perceived trust, especially for e-commerce or local businesses.
  5. Regularly Update Content: Outdated information can harm credibility, so ensure your content remains current and accurate.
